Frequently asked questions

What is data center IT asset disposition?
Data center IT asset disposition (ITAD) is the secure process of retiring, sanitizing, reusing, remarketing, recycling or disposing of IT equipment at the end of its lifecycle while protecting data and supporting compliance.
What assets are included in a data center decommissioning project?
Projects typically include servers, storage systems, networking equipment, racks, switches, firewalls, cables, power distribution units (PDUs), UPS systems and other supporting IT infrastructure.
How do ITAD services support data center decommissioning?
ITAD services securely remove, track, sanitize, transport, remarket, recycle or dispose of retired IT assets while providing chain of custody and compliance documentation.
How is data destroyed during data center decommissioning?
Data is securely destroyed using certified sanitization methods, such as software-based erasure or physical destruction of storage media, depending on security and compliance requirements.
What happens to retired servers and storage devices?
Assets are evaluated for reuse or resale whenever possible. Equipment that cannot be repurposed is responsibly recycled or disposed of in accordance with environmental regulations.
How can organizations maximize value recovery during a decommissioning project?
Working with an experienced ITAD provider helps identify assets with resale value, enabling refurbishment and remarketing to offset decommissioning costs.

According to Gartner®,

The three most important tasks to execute correctly, and to which ITAD executives should pay special attention, are transportation logistics/chain of custody, data sanitization, and recycling. These three tasks represent the greatest risk in the ITAD process, and they should be handled by an experienced, well-vetted ITAD service provider.

Customer success story: hyperscale services provider

Challenge

Arrival of new servers and storage, which were rapidly losing value while waiting for installation, placed a premium on accelerating decommissioning for this hyperscale services provider. While the nature of the business mandated maximum data security, the provider needed return on investment from asset remarketing to help fund increased tech refreshes.

Solution

Iron Mountain’s custom data center decommissioning services safely, securely, and efficiently executed comprehensive data erasure, uninstallation, removal, and secure shipment of equipment to state-of-the-art processing facilities for remarketing.

Results

All racks were data-free and ready to be wheeled out four days after the project started. All assets were removed from the client site within 14 days. Remarketing the retired assets netted the client several million dollars, helping to close budget gaps.

By the numbers

  • 297
    racks
  • 121,893
    drives (HDD, SSD, flash cards)
  • 100%
    of drives erased or securely destroyed, with certification
  • 4 days
    data elimination complete
  • 2 weeks
    all racks removed
  • $4.4M
    client proceeds
